Where Are Ostrich Ferns Native? Matteuccia struthiopteris, commonly known as ostrich fern, is native to temperate regions of North America, Europe and northern Asia. It is typically found in wooded river bottomlands. Are ostrich ferns invasive? Ostrich fern fiddleheads, Matteuccia struthiopteris, are currently only harvested commercially from the wild, though much research has been done in New Brunswick, Canada, to be able to cultivate ostrich ferns commercially. Where To Buy Fiddlehead Ferns? The fertile sandy soil beside waterways are prime areas to find fiddleheads. They can also be found in wet woods and flood plains.
